Inexpensive Hearing Aids: Options for Every Budget

Hearing loss touches millions of people worldwide, and the cost of hearing aids can be a major barrier to treatment. Luckily, there are now many budget-friendly options available that make hearing healthier more reachable.

Since you're on a tight budget or simply looking for value, explore the following choices:

* Over-the-ear hearing aids are becoming increasingly popular due to their ease of use. These devices can be purchased directly from retailers without a prescription.

Used or refurbished hearing aids can offer significant savings compared to acquiring new ones. Be sure to buy from a reliable source and have the devices inspected by an audiologist before use.

*

Many insurance plans now provide at least some of the cost of hearing aids. Contact your plan administrator to find out what your benefits are.

Non-profit organizations such as the Sertoma International may offer financial assistance programs or reductions on hearing aids.

Where to Obtain Hearing Aids: Navigating Your Choices

Hearing loss is a common condition that can affect people of all ages. If you're experiencing hearing difficulties, it's important to explore professional help. One essential step in managing your hearing loss is finding the right hearing aids. There are many different alternatives available, and choosing the best pair for you can be overwhelming. This article will assist you through the process of where to purchase hearing aids.

Your journey might begin at your family physician's office. They can perform a basic hearing test and refer you to an audiologist for a more comprehensive evaluation. Audiologists are specialists who assess hearing impairments and recommend the most suitable hearing aids based on your individual needs.

  • You can also visit a local hearing center or specialist clinic. These facilities often have qualified audiologists who can provide you with expert advice and fitting services.
  • In recent years, the availability of hearing aids online has grown. Many reputable stores now offer a wide selection of hearing aids directly to consumers.

It's important to remember that choosing hearing aids is a unique decision. What works best for one person may not be the ideal solution for another. Take your time, investigate your alternatives, and consult qualified professionals to ensure you find the hearing aids that best meet your requirements.
